California Braces Itself For More Earthquakes

By Nova News
July 7, 2019
Est. Reading: 1 minute

Loading

Loading

Experts say the risk of more earthquakes in Southern California is "approaching certainty."

A powerful quake with a magnitude of 7-point-1 struck on Friday night - local time - near the city of Ridgecrest - around 150 miles north-east of Los Angeles.

According to CBS San Francisco, the biggest natural disaster threat facing everyone in the Bay Area is a quake on the Hayward fault.

Geologists say at any time, that fault line could trigger an even bigger quake than the two that just shocked Southern California.
